Join Tamron and Hunt’s Photo Education on a 2-day video production workshop featuring The Kitchen in Melrose!

Tamron Americas and Hunt’s Photo Education are teaming up for a special video workshop led by renowned photographer and filmmaker André Costantini. In this hands-on event, participants will learn essential video production skills while collaborating on a branding-style video for The Kitchen–a cooking school near our Hunt’s Melrose location– for use on social media. The workshop offers a unique opportunity to work with industry professionals, gain practical experience, and contribute to a meaningful project supporting a local culinary institution. Whether you’re a beginner or an experienced creator, this workshop promises valuable insights and a chance to make a real impact through visual storytelling!

This is a 2-Part class. Part 1 will be a Video Production Seminar on Friday October 17th, 6-8pm in our Hunt’s Melrose store location.  We will reconvene on Saturday, October 18th from 10am-12pm for our Hands-On Location Shoot at The Kitchen in Melrose, located about a mile from our Hunt’s Melrose store. After shooting, we will return to Hunt’s Melrose for lunch, provided by Tamron, from 12:30-1:30pm. We will then hold a Video Editing Class from 2-5pm in our Hunt’s Melrose classroom.

About Gear- Each attendee will have an opportunity to create footage during the production portion, but we will all be working together as a group and working on elements of production. Tamron will also have loaner lenses available to use!

About André Costantini

André is a filmmaker, editor, photographer, and musician. He has spent the past 20 years creating commissioned documentary and industrial films and an award-winning comedy. André has produced and directed several films for PBS including the New England Emmy Award winning film featured the Pulitzer Prize and World Press photojournalist John Moore. His relationship with Tamron spans almost 30 years.
